Output 04cc666531d25d26275f242164ae5b3fd489137a4143cfbe4146b2d6309fd059:24

value
1966
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 09baf5dafdd614198c093b5e827e1dfc4339e014f6db2eeba4a15d094e59c793
address
bc1ppxa0tkha6c2pnrqf8d0gylsal3pnncq57mdja6ay59wsjnjec7fsdr7598
transaction
04cc666531d25d26275f242164ae5b3fd489137a4143cfbe4146b2d6309fd059
spent
true